torah

n.
1.the whole body of the Jewish sacred writings and tradition including the oral tradition
2.the first of three divisions of the Hebrew Scriptures comprising the first five books of the Hebrew Bible considered as a unit
3.(Judaism) the scroll of parchment on which the first five books of the Hebrew Scripture is written

  • Idiom of the Day

    sadder but wiser
    unhappy about something but having learned something from the experience
    The man was sadder but wiser after he learned that his wallet had been stolen.
